DEBIAN-CVE-2026-41140

Source
https://security-tracker.debian.org/tracker/CVE-2026-41140
Import Source
https://storage.googleapis.com/debian-osv/debian-cve-osv/DEBIAN-CVE-2026-41140.json
JSON Data
https://api.osv.dev/v1/vulns/DEBIAN-CVE-2026-41140
Upstream
  • CVE-2026-41140
Published
2026-04-24T18:16:28.613Z
Modified
2026-05-08T16:01:01.806675Z
Severity
  • 0.6 (Low) CVSS_V4 - CVSS:4.0/AV:N/AC:L/AT:P/PR:N/UI:P/VC:N/VI:L/VA:N/SC:N/SI:N/SA:N/E:U/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X CVSS Calculator
Summary
[none]
Details

Poetry is a dependency manager for Python. Prior to 2.3.4, the extractall() function in src/poetry/utils/helpers.py:410-426 extracts sdist tarballs without path traversal protection on Python versions where tarfile.data_filter is unavailable. Considering only Python versions which are still supported by Poetry, these are 3.10.0 - 3.10.12 and 3.11.0 - 3.11.4. This vulnerability is fixed in 2.3.4.

References

Affected packages

Debian:12 / poetry

Package

Name
poetry
Purl
pkg:deb/debian/poetry?arch=source

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ected

Affected versions

1.*
1.3.2+dfsg-3
1.3.2+dfsg-4
1.3.2+dfsg-5
1.5.1+dfsg-1
1.5.1+dfsg-2
1.5.1+dfsg-3
1.5.1+dfsg-4
1.6.1+dfsg-1
1.6.1+dfsg-2
1.7.1+dfsg-1
1.8.0.dev0~git20240220.cff4d7d5+dfsg-1
1.8.0.dev0~git20240220.cff4d7d5+dfsg-2
1.8.2+dfsg-1
1.8.3+dfsg-1
1.8.3+dfsg-2
1.8.3+dfsg-3
1.8.3+dfsg-4
2.*
2.0.1+dfsg-1
2.1.1+dfsg-1
2.1.1+dfsg-2
2.1.1+dfsg-3
2.1.2+dfsg-1
2.2.1+dfsg-1
2.2.1+dfsg-2
2.2.1+dfsg-3
2.3.2+dfsg-1
2.3.2+dfsg-2
2.3.2+dfsg-3

Ecosystem specific

{
    "urgency": "not yet assigned"
}

Database specific

source
"https://storage.googleapis.com/debian-osv/debian-cve-osv/DEBIAN-CVE-2026-41140.json"

Debian:13 / poetry

Package

Name
poetry
Purl
pkg:deb/debian/poetry?arch=source

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
2.1.2+dfsg-1

Ecosystem specific

{
    "urgency": "not yet assigned"
}

Database specific

source
"https://storage.googleapis.com/debian-osv/debian-cve-osv/DEBIAN-CVE-2026-41140.json"

Debian:14 / poetry

Package

Name
poetry
Purl
pkg:deb/debian/poetry?arch=source

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
2.1.2+dfsg-1

Ecosystem specific

{
    "urgency": "not yet assigned"
}

Database specific

source
"https://storage.googleapis.com/debian-osv/debian-cve-osv/DEBIAN-CVE-2026-41140.json"